On January 12, 1885 in Celtic History
Molly allgood, actress, born

Molly Allgood, actress (stage name Máire O’Neill) and she lived until 1952. She had a successful career in the theater and appeared in many productions in Ireland and the United Kingdom. Molly Allgood was associated with the Abbey Theatre in Dublin and worked alongside other renowned Irish playwrights and actors.
